Can you connect two inverters in parallel?

Absolutely. Sometimes a single inverter cannot provide enough power to meet the demand. In such cases, connecting two inverters in parallel becomes a practical solution. This approach is commonly used for off-grid solar systems, backup power setups, and other scenarios requiring higher power (e.g., industrial applications).

What is grid-connected current of inverters in parallel operation?

Hou et al. point out that the grid-connected current of inverters in parallel operation consists of three parts, namely the average current, ZSCC and differential circulating current and a decomposed current control scheme is proposed to minimise the differential current from equivalent circuit models.

Why do inverters run in parallel?

Running inverters in parallel boosts power capacity by combining outputs of multiple inverters, catering to higher energy demands without overloading. It enhances reliability as if one fails, others continue supplying power. Also, it allows easy expansion, accommodating future energy needs.
